						<section id="A"><p><span class="prefix-number">A.</span> Whenever an <span class="dictionary">institution</span>&#x2019;s <span class="dictionary">fund</span> is inadequate to carry out fully the purpose for which the <span class="dictionary">fund</span> was established, the <span class="dictionary">governing board</span> and <span class="dictionary">chief executive officer</span> of such <span class="dictionary">institution</span>, with the prior written consent and approval of the Governor, are authorized, for the purpose of providing an additional <span class="dictionary">fund</span>, to borrow from such sources and on such terms as may be approved by the Governor an amount not to exceed $25,000 and provide for such extensions or renewals of such loans as may be necessary. Such additional <span class="dictionary">fund</span> shall be used only in making loans to <span class="dictionary">students</span> as provided in this article and for no other purpose. <a id="paragraph-258095" class="section-permalink" href="https://vacode.org/23.1-621/#A"><i class="fa fa-link"/></a></p></section>
						<section id="B"><p><span class="prefix-number">B.</span> The repayments and interest accretions to the additional <span class="dictionary">fund</span> shall be used insofar as may be necessary to repay the indebtedness of the <span class="dictionary">institution</span> created by the <span class="dictionary">governing board</span> and <span class="dictionary">chief executive officer</span> in establishing such additional <span class="dictionary">fund</span>. <a id="paragraph-258096" class="section-permalink" href="https://vacode.org/23.1-621/#B"><i class="fa fa-link"/></a></p></section>
						<section id="C"><p><span class="prefix-number">C.</span> Such additional amounts may be borrowed as may be deemed necessary by the <span class="dictionary">governing board</span> and <span class="dictionary">chief executive officer</span> of the <span class="dictionary">institution</span>, with the Governor&#x2019;s approval, but in no event shall the amount of the additional <span class="dictionary">fund</span>, including cash, notes receivable, and all amounts borrowed and not repaid exceed $50,000. <a id="paragraph-258097" class="section-permalink" href="https://vacode.org/23.1-621/#C"><i class="fa fa-link"/></a></p></section>
						<section id="D"><p><span class="prefix-number">D.</span> Accounts shall be kept and reports rendered for each such additional <span class="dictionary">fund</span> in all respects as required by this article for <span class="dictionary">funds</span> created by appropriations from the general <span class="dictionary">fund</span> of the state treasury and the Auditor of Public Accounts shall biennially exhibit in his report the amount of the additional <span class="dictionary">fund</span> at each <span class="dictionary">institution</span>. <a id="paragraph-258098" class="section-permalink" href="https://vacode.org/23.1-621/#D"><i class="fa fa-link"/></a></p></section></text><history>1978, c. 745, &#xA7; 23-38.10:7; 2016, c. 588.</history><metadata></metadata></law>
